Etymology: Capoeta: The local vernacular name "kapwaeti" used in Georgia and Azerbaikhan (Ref. 45335); alborzensis: Named for the Alborz Mountains (Tehran Province, Iran), where the Nam River is originated.

Short description Claves de identificación | Morfología | Morfometría

This species is distinguished from its congeners of Iran by the following set of characters, none of which are unique: barbels only one pair; snout rounded; lateral line scales 39-44; scales rows between lateral line and dorsal-fin origin 6-8 and between lateral line and anal-fin origin 5-8; gill rakers on the first gill arch 19-22; mouth small and transverse; prepelvic length 53-56 %SL; snout length 31-39 %SL; short barbel, 10-12% HL (Ref. 129198).

Biología     Glosario (por ej. epibenthic)

Occurs in large streams and is more frequent in the main flow of large rivers. Its type locality, the Nam River has a temperatureof 24°C, with pH 7.1 and conductivity of 0.675 μS,. The current was medium to fast, river width about 2-17 m, with maximum depth up to 1.5 m, the shore is grassy, and with gravel as stream-bed. Associated fishes found in the type locality were Capoeta buhsei, Alburnoides coadi, Barbus miliaris, Squalius namak, Oncorhynchus mykiss, and Paracobitis malapterura (Ref. 129198).
